Thoughts On - The "Predator" prequel - "Prey" (No spoilers)

 Hi Everyone,

                      PREY - This was my Christmas Movie of 2024. I had missed it when it first came out in 2022, then planned to watch it at a mate's abode, but the chance arose to see it on my cable offering this festive season. The plot is that our Native American heroine wants to hunt with the rest of the warriors, which is a traditionally male job, as you can imagine. They are not too keen. Things get a bit messy when our unfriendly fanged tourist shows up and begins chopping its way through our local wildlife. It works its way up the food chain, and everything goes sideways from there.

                    Looking at the odds on paper, it does seem to be a rather one-sided contest; you would usually put your dosh on the big guy. But there lies the tension of the film. How many trophies will it get? Will it eat her dog? Will our heroine survive, in one or more pieces? You will have to hunt out PREY to find out. There is no fantastic acting in it, but it is a fairly young cast, so that can be forgiven. It is worth a watch if it is on catch-up or you are at a friend's night-in.

Rating - 4 out of 5.

Thoughts on - Films Lockdown DVD (No Spoilers)

 Hi Everyone,

                      I have just seen the film Lockdown and I am sure that it would make a great plot for a science fiction adventure game or tabletop skirmish wargame at your preferred scale and rule set. Our damsel in distress, Miss X is visiting an orbiting prison, for the reason of Y. There is a jailbreak because of Z. The authorities have to send in our hero or heroes to rescue her and find where "something" has been hidden, otherwise, he will be charged and locked up in the same jail, for doing naughty things that he has been framed for. You can do a "One Off" game or spread it over multiple game sessions as your heroes work their way through the different levels of the facility to rescue Miss X.

I saw the trailer of this film when it first came out, but I missed it at the cinema, I am so glad I finally spotted it at my local movie store. The visuals (meaning blood and gore special effects) and acting are very good. That's another reason to watch it, by the way.
